Slovak fund admits risks of commercial properties

by Property Forum
After an unprecedented rise in interest rates, the CE REIF fund has reassessed the price of real estate in its portfolio. Last year's loss is reaching almost 30%, reports DennikN.sk. It is the first real estate fund in Slovakia that has admitted the problems of commercial real estate.

Slovakia postpones new Construction Act

by Property Forum
The Construction Act in Slovakia has been in force for half a century, and this year will probably not be its last either. The new Construction Act, or the Construction Act and Spatial Planning Act, was supposed to enter into force in Slovakia on 1st April 2024. The validity of part of the new legislation will be postponed, reports yimba.sk.

Penta moves ahead with €200 million project in Bratislava

by Property Forum
Plots with a total area of ​​4.5 ha at the intersection of Vajnorská and Odborárská streets in the neighbourhood of Istrochem in Bratislava were acquired by Penta Real Estate for an unspecified price in 2022. Through its subsidiary UNL, Penta has now submitted its investment plan to the authorities for an environmental impact assessment, reports DenníkN.
